Output 641117662fb1e9f792146b15d98db8664abcf98cbcb50d8fe0960159d83b5cd6:12

value
190416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5dd30b4087b816bf10c46674b85537604f8ee39 OP_EQUAL
address
3MBppyJ9J2uPWNDWh1vofoymbqifn6YDy6
transaction
641117662fb1e9f792146b15d98db8664abcf98cbcb50d8fe0960159d83b5cd6
spent
true